uNPE: Unified Network Protocol Encapsulation for Highly Transparent Future Networks

To improve in-band network control and enable the rapid deployment of new protocols, we devise a re-framing scheme that we call unified Network Protocol Encapsulation (uNPE). uNPE maps control information that previously resided in the nested headers of many Internet protocols onto a set of data units unified in a single layer and logically divided into three control groups: connection, network function, and application function. By liberating the control information from the rigid framing of the nested protocol headers, uNPE increases transparency and flexibility for future networks, empowering network control and simplifying the design of new protocols. Using the P4 language for programmable data planes we prototype uNPE and show that it can substantially improve essential network functions such as routing and congestion control.
